From beautiful Sofia, wind your way all the way down the Balkan Peninsula, relaxing in Macedonia, touching Albania and really getting beneath that tourist veneer in Greece. In Bulgaria enjoy a visit to the exquisite Rila Monastery before lunch beside a tumbling river. In Macedonia relax in Alexander the Great’s Skopje, with its enormous statues, and grand old Turkish Bazaar before cruising under the cliffs of the gorgeous Matka Canyon to the Vrelo Caves. Relax over three nights beside the shores of delightful Lake Ohrid, take in the panoramic views of the lake from Tsar Samuel's Fortress, enjoy a lake cruise to visit Naum Monastery, the Freshwater springs and lakeside lunch. Discover the UNESCO listed ‘Bay of Bones’ reconstructed village built of wooden piles sunk into the crystal-clear lake waters, drive deep into Greece’s spectacular Pindos Mountains to stay three nights in the fabulous, multi award winning Aristi Mountain Resort. Explore the UNESCO listed Zagori region known for its steep mountains and cliffs, perched Monasteries, stone bridges and timeless feeling remote villages, and dine on a shady terrace with views across the enormous Vikos Gorge. Visit Corfu, explore the old town and take an exclusive 4WD tour deep into the mountains, for a remote village lunch. Stay 2 nights in Kalabaka and visit three of Meteora’s amazing, perched monasteries, visit Delphi’s incredible ruins and dine in a shady restaurant high over the olive tree filled plains and the Sea of Corinth. At Thermopylae, take in the site of the famous Spartan stand against the Persians and spend a final night beside the beach nearby beautiful Cape Sounion. After a refreshing dip in the crystal-clear sea, relax through the evening beside the magnificent 2,500-year-old, cliff top ruins of the Temple of Poseidon and take in the awesome sunset spilling over the Aegeon Islands.
